The purpose of this study is to find out whether there is an influence of professional attitudes (x 1) on teacher performance (y), the influence of work motivation (x 2) on teacher work performance (y), the influence of work discipline (X3) on teacher performance and to find out how much influence professional attitudes (x 1), work motivation needs (x 2) and work discipline (x 3 ) collectively affect teacher performance (y). The method used in this study is an observation method, with a quantitative approach of correlation and regression. The total sample of 45 people was taken from the teaching staff at Muhammadiyah 1Ponorogo High School. The data processing method uses multiple regression analysis. The results showed that the professional attitude variable i (x 1) there was a significant influence on teacher performance (y) as evidenced by the efficiency of the professional attitude variable i (x 1) with a calculated t test value of 3.225 > ttable 2.019, while the work motivation variable(x2 ) with a calculated t test value of 3.924 whose value is greater than t table 2.019, as for the work discipline variable (x 3) with a t hitun g test valueof 3.583 >2.019. Based on the f test, it shows that the probability value < 0.05, it can be said that there is a significant influence together between the free variables and the bound variables. This means that there is a positive influence between professional attitudes (x 1), work motivation (x 2), work discipline (x3) on teacher performance (y). The conclusion of the study based on the calculations above shows that there is a significant influence between professional attitude, work motivation and work discipline on teacher performance. Based on the results of the analysis, it can be concluded that together professional attitudes, work motivation and work discipline have a significant positive influence on the performance of teachers of SMA Muhammadiyah 1 Ponorogo
